v

[ActionScript 3] 배열의 특정 원소 삭제하기

function array_slice(target_array:Array, target_num:Number){
 for(var i=0; i<target_array.length; i++){
   if(i==target_num){
    target_array.splice(i,1);
   }
 }
}
 
사용방법: array_slice("배열명", 삭제할 배열번호);
|

댓글 2개

php 의 array_slice 와 개념이 좀 다르군요.
중간 인덱스부터 삭제할수 없으니까 slide 를 쓰는것 같네요.
(삭제한뒤에는 length가 줄어들어야함)

배열에서 index 0 부터 값을 뺄때는 pop 을 쓰죠.
댓글을 작성하시려면 로그인이 필요합니다.

프로그램

+
제목 글쓴이 날짜 조회
14년 전 조회 1,143
14년 전 조회 1,719
14년 전 조회 2,242
14년 전 조회 1,288
14년 전 조회 1,767
14년 전 조회 1,289
14년 전 조회 1,661
14년 전 조회 3,095
14년 전 조회 1,137
14년 전 조회 5,363
14년 전 조회 1,150
14년 전 조회 1,323
14년 전 조회 1,157
14년 전 조회 3,884
14년 전 조회 960
14년 전 조회 1,312
14년 전 조회 1,595
14년 전 조회 1,616
14년 전 조회 1,085
14년 전 조회 1,708
14년 전 조회 1,173
14년 전 조회 1,047
14년 전 조회 2,730
14년 전 조회 1,456
14년 전 조회 1,060
14년 전 조회 1,032
14년 전 조회 2,088
14년 전 조회 1,245
14년 전 조회 1,659
14년 전 조회 1,635
14년 전 조회 2,301
14년 전 조회 2,301
14년 전 조회 1,582
14년 전 조회 1,207
14년 전 조회 1,166
14년 전 조회 1,377
14년 전 조회 1,557
14년 전 조회 3,099
14년 전 조회 1,029
14년 전 조회 1,360
14년 전 조회 1,503
14년 전 조회 1,879
14년 전 조회 1,084
14년 전 조회 984
14년 전 조회 1,692
14년 전 조회 2,061
14년 전 조회 2,165
14년 전 조회 1,394
14년 전 조회 1,129
14년 전 조회 2,266
14년 전 조회 1,346
14년 전 조회 1,689
14년 전 조회 1,136
14년 전 조회 1,202
14년 전 조회 1,229
14년 전 조회 1,295
14년 전 조회 5,169
14년 전 조회 1,183
14년 전 조회 1,321
14년 전 조회 1,987
14년 전 조회 1,122
14년 전 조회 914
14년 전 조회 1,316
14년 전 조회 2,593
14년 전 조회 2,045
14년 전 조회 1,881
14년 전 조회 3,377
14년 전 조회 2,417
14년 전 조회 1,368
14년 전 조회 1,409
14년 전 조회 1,391
14년 전 조회 1,518
14년 전 조회 967
14년 전 조회 1,283
14년 전 조회 1,406
14년 전 조회 3,006
14년 전 조회 1,292
14년 전 조회 1,030
14년 전 조회 1,033
14년 전 조회 3,372
14년 전 조회 1,152
14년 전 조회 1,865
14년 전 조회 1,976
14년 전 조회 1,070
14년 전 조회 1,780
14년 전 조회 1,167
14년 전 조회 1,315
14년 전 조회 2,249
14년 전 조회 2,036
14년 전 조회 2,592
14년 전 조회 1,301
14년 전 조회 1,175
14년 전 조회 2,552
14년 전 조회 1,200
14년 전 조회 1,297
14년 전 조회 2,506
14년 전 조회 1,403
14년 전 조회 1,389
14년 전 조회 1,093
14년 전 조회 1,357